Germany typically has 250 to 260 workdays per year. This calculation assumes a 5-day workweek, subtracting weekends and public holidays. It's crucial for planning purposes, whether you're scheduling business activities or planning personal events.

- How is the number of workdays calculated in Germany? Workdays are calculated by subtracting weekends and public holidays from the total days in the year.
- What are the public holidays in Germany? Germany has several public holidays that vary by region; common ones include New Year's Day, Easter, and Christmas.
